The APEX 3D S™ Stemmed Tibia is a complimentary implant to the APEX 3D™ Total Ankle Replacement System. Offering surgeons intra-operative flexibility, the APEX 3D S™ expands the continuum of care for patients with ankle arthritis plus other characteristics such as diabetes, high BMI, prior hindfoot fusion, etc., with features which have been proven to reduce post-surgery complications¹:
✓ Vertical Fixation
✓ Enhanced Stability
✓ Minimally Disruptive Insertion
The APEX 3D S™ Stemmed Tibia instrumentation includes the Right-Angle Drill which offers precision instrumentation for prepping the tibia prior to implantation. A Linear Guide attaches to the Tibia Trial guiding the Right-Angle Drill vertically into the tibia with fluoro markers indicating that the appropriate depth as been established. Additionally, the drill can be used on both hard and soft bone.
